From bdd9c8541f5df134ad5460ef192c7dc019e893eb Mon Sep 17 00:00:00 2001 From: Ted Gould Date: Wed, 11 Aug 2010 09:05:07 -0500 Subject: Ensuring that we got a list of keys so we don't crash --- src/application-service-appstore.c | 9 ++++++++- 1 file changed, 8 insertions(+), 1 deletion(-) diff --git a/src/application-service-appstore.c b/src/application-service-appstore.c index d632456..2306230 100644 --- a/src/application-service-appstore.c +++ b/src/application-service-appstore.c @@ -273,7 +273,14 @@ load_override_file (GHashTable * hash, const gchar * filename) return; } - gchar ** keys = g_key_file_get_keys(keyfile, OVERRIDE_GROUP_NAME, NULL, NULL); + gchar ** keys = g_key_file_get_keys(keyfile, OVERRIDE_GROUP_NAME, NULL, &error); + if (error != NULL) { + g_warning("Unable to get keys from keyfile '%s' because: %s", filename, error->message); + g_error_free(error); + g_key_file_free(keyfile); + return; + } + gchar * key = keys[0]; gint i; -- cgit v1.2.3 From 77343b7e956416b2d2a8e45b5a2a2e683e1ed836 Mon Sep 17 00:00:00 2001 From: Ted Gould Date: Wed, 11 Aug 2010 09:06:41 -0500 Subject: Typo --- data/ordering-override.keyfile |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/data/ordering-override.keyfile b/data/ordering-override.keyfile index 6665b7a..dcfb75b 100644 --- a/data/ordering-override.keyfile +++ b/data/ordering-override.keyfile @@ -1,2 +1,2 @@ -[Ordering Index Overides] +[Ordering Index Overrides] gnome-power-manager=1 -- cgit v1.2.3